/*generated inline style */ Company Profile  

With more than 120 operations and approximately 20,000 employees worldwide, Precision Castparts Corp. is the market leader in manufacturing large, complex structural investment castings, airfoil castings, forged components, aerostructures and highly engineered, critical fasteners for aerospace applications. In addition, we are the leading producer of airfoil castings for the industrial gas turbine market. We also manufacture extruded seamless pipe, fittings, and forgings for power generation and oil & gas applications; commercial and military airframe aerostructures; and metal alloys and other materials for the casting and forging industries. With such critical applications, we insist on quality and dependability – not just in the materials and products we make, but in the people we recruit.

PCC is relentless in its dedication to being a high-quality, low-cost and on-time producer; delivering the highest value to its customers while continually pursuing strategic, profitable growth.

In 2016, Berkshire Hathaway, led by Chairman and CEO Warren E. Buffett, acquired Precision Castparts Corp.

/*generated inline style */ Job Description  

Mission:

To assist the Master Scheduler in maintaining a valid and realistic Master Production Schedule supporting the Business Unit Sales, and customer orders. To insure effective communication on schedules is coordinated with Sales, Planning, Manufacturing and Engineering.  The main purpose of this job is to assist in meeting on time delivery to the customer, process router changes, fix delivery dates based on span changes and modify Bill of Materials. Individuals assigned to the Alloy Service Center (ASC) will be responsible for shipping, receiving and managing all inventory required to support production.
